Dual output LNB to use for single reiever?
what's up everyone? I didn't get my receiver yet, wasn't at home to sign for it but they will be back out here tomorrow. my question now is I had DTV that allowed the lnb hook up to 2 receivers, I no longer have them "DTV", can I use the same lnb to hook up 1 receiver the cw800s?, and also can I pick up international channels with the cw800s if I get another dish?

Re: Dual output LNB to use for single reiever?
if the dtv lnb is the single eye lnb then yes you can use it to pickup 1 sat unless you have a motor
yes the cw800 will pickup the same channels as all other stbs except hd channels

Re: Dual output LNB to use for single reiever?
Quote:
Originally Posted by jrsbasura
Thank You Bigevil69. so does it matter which coax I use to run to my receiver? or is it the same? If I pick up another receiver later on can I use the other coax from the same lnb to view different program?
Once again Thank You
jrsbasura
|
no it does not matter which side you use and yes you can run another stb off the other port
Quote:
Originally Posted by jrsbasura
also I want to try to pick up 110 and 119, so then do I just buy another single eye lnb and duck tape it to the right?
Thank You
jrsbasura
|
take and lock this one on 110w then get another one and attach to the left side (standing behind the dish) of that lnb but it will have to be just a little bit higher
use tie straps instead of duct tape and once you get it set just right then run some super glue around the seam of where the 2 meet
